Introduction
Dulquer Salmaan, fondly known as DQ, is one of the most versatile and charismatic actors in the Indian film industry. The son of legendary actor Mammootty, Dulquer has carved a niche for himself with his impeccable performances across multiple languages, including Malayalam, Tamil, Telugu, and Hindi. His filmography boasts a mix of romantic dramas, action thrillers, and experimental cinema. 1. Ustad Hotel (2012)
A Heartwarming Tale of Love and Food
One of Dulquer’s earliest hits, "Ustad Hotel", directed by Anwar Rasheed, tells the story of a young man named Faizi who aspires to be a chef but faces opposition from his father. The film beautifully blends themes of passion, family, and social responsibility, making it a must-watch.
2. Bangalore Days (2014)
A Youthful Tale of Friendship and Love
Anjali Menon’s "Bangalore Days" is a delightful coming-of-age drama featuring an ensemble cast. Dulquer plays Arjun, a carefree and rebellious biker who undergoes personal growth through friendships and love. His performance was lauded for its depth and charm.
3. Charlie (2015)
A Whimsical Adventure
This visually stunning film, directed by Martin Prakkat, features Dulquer as Charlie, a free-spirited vagabond who brings joy to everyone he meets. The film’s poetic storytelling and mesmerizing cinematography, combined with Dulquer’s magnetic performance, make it one of his best.
4. Kali (2016)
A High-Octane Thriller
In "Kali", Dulquer plays Siddharth, a man struggling with anger management issues. The intense performances by Dulquer and Sai Pallavi, coupled with a gripping screenplay, make this thriller a riveting watch.
5. Kammatipaadam (2016)
A Hard-Hitting Crime Drama
Rajeev Ravi’s "Kammatipaadam" sees Dulquer in a gritty role as Krishnan, a man reflecting on his past life involving crime and friendship. This film showcased a completely different side of Dulquer’s acting prowess.
6. Solo (2017)
An Experimental Anthology
Bejoy Nambiar’s "Solo" is a collection of four stories based on the elements—earth, fire, wind, and water. Dulquer plays four different characters, proving his ability to portray diverse roles within a single film.
7. Mahanati (2018)
A Tribute to the Golden Era of Cinema
In this Telugu biopic of legendary actress Savitri, Dulquer plays Gemini Ganesan. His portrayal of the charismatic yet flawed Tamil superstar was widely appreciated, making it one of his most memorable performances.
8. Karwaan (2018)
A Soulful Road Trip Movie
Dulquer made his Bollywood debut with "Karwaan", alongside Irrfan Khan and Mithila Palkar. The film is a heartwarming journey of self-discovery with a touch of humor and emotion.
9. Kannum Kannum Kollaiyadithaal (2020)
A Smart Romantic Heist Thriller
This Tamil film, directed by Desingh Periyasamy, features Dulquer in a stylish con-artist role. The film’s engaging storyline, unexpected twists, and Dulquer’s charming screen presence make it a fun watch.
10. Kurup (2021)
A Stylish Crime Drama
One of the most ambitious projects in Dulquer’s career, "Kurup" is based on the real-life fugitive Sukumara Kurup. The film’s gripping narrative and Dulquer’s effortless transformation into a notorious criminal make it one of his best performances.
11. Sita Ramam (2022)
A Timeless Love Story
"Sita Ramam" is a heartwarming romantic drama where Dulquer plays Ram, an army officer who falls in love through letters. The film’s poetic storytelling, stunning visuals, and Dulquer’s endearing performance make it a modern classic.
12. Lucky Bhaskar (2024)
A Thrilling Financial Drama
"Lucky Bhaskar" is one of Dulquer’s latest films, showcasing him in a gripping financial thriller. This movie revolves around the journey of an ordinary man who becomes an influential figure in the world of finance. Dulquer’s nuanced performance and the film’s compelling storyline make it a must-watch.

FAQs
1. What is Dulquer Salmaan’s best movie?
While opinions vary, Charlie, Kali, and Sita Ramam are among his most praised films.
2. Has Dulquer Salmaan acted in Bollywood movies?
Yes, he has acted in Bollywood films like Karwaan and The Zoya Factor.
3. Which Dulquer Salmaan film is based on a real-life story?
Kurup(2021) is inspired by the true story of Sukumara Kurup, one of India’s most wanted fugitives.
4. What was Dulquer Salmaan’s debut film?
He made his acting debut with Second Show (2012).
5. Is Dulquer Salmaan only active in Malayalam cinema?
No, he has acted in multiple languages, including Tamil, Telugu, and Hindi.
